🐱 Crochet Cat Organizer Pattern
Keep your craft tools neat and tidy with this adorable crochet cat organizer! With its round base, roomy pockets, and sweet kitty face, it’s both functional and irresistibly cute.
✨ Skill Level
Intermediate – Includes shaping, separate pieces (pockets, ears, muzzle), and sewing.
📏 Finished Size
Approx. 12 in (30 cm) tall with a base diameter of 6–7 in (15–18 cm) when made with bulky yarn and a 5.0 mm hook.
🧶 Materials
- Bulky cotton yarn:
- Color A: Light grey (main body, head, ears, tail, pockets)
- Color B: White (eye outline, muzzle)
- Color C: Black (pupils, whiskers, mouth)
- Color D: Pink (nose, ear lining)
- Crochet hook: 5.0 mm
- 2 × 20–24 mm safety eyes or crocheted pupils
- Polyfill stuffing (for head & tail)
- Cardboard/plastic circle (optional for stiffening base)
- Tapestry needle
- Scissors
- Stitch markers
🧵 Abbreviations (US Terms)
MR – Magic Ring
sc – Single Crochet
inc – Increase (2 sc in same st)
dec – Decrease (sc 2 together)
sl st – Slip Stitch
ch – Chain
FO – Fasten Off
🔽 Pattern Instructions
🐾 Base
With Color A:
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- inc x6 (12)
- (1 sc, inc) x6 (18)
- (2 sc, inc) x6 (24)
- (3 sc, inc) x6 (30)
- (4 sc, inc) x6 (36)
- (5 sc, inc) x6 (42)
- (6 sc, inc) x6 (48)
- (7 sc, inc) x6 (54)
- (8 sc, inc) x6 (60)
- (9 sc, inc) x6 (66)
👉 Optional: Insert stiff circle at bottom for stability.
🐱 Body
Continue with Color A:
12–22. sc around (66) – straight section for pocket attachment.
23. (9 sc, dec) x6 (60)
24–25. sc around (60)
26. (8 sc, dec) x6 (54)
27–28. sc around (54)
FO, leave long tail for sewing to base later.
📦 Pockets (Make 6)
With Color A:
- Ch 13, sc in 2nd ch from hook and across (12).
2–10. sc across (12).
FO, leaving tail for sewing.
Sew pockets evenly spaced around the body (6 total). Stitch sides securely but leave tops open.
🐱 Head
With Color A:
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- inc x6 (12)
- (1 sc, inc) x6 (18)
- (2 sc, inc) x6 (24)
- (3 sc, inc) x6 (30)
- (4 sc, inc) x6 (36)
- (5 sc, inc) x6 (42)
- (6 sc, inc) x6 (48)
- (7 sc, inc) x6 (54)
10–20. sc around (54) – extra rounds for large, full head - (7 sc, dec) x6 (48)
- (6 sc, dec) x6 (42)
- (5 sc, dec) x6 (36)
- (4 sc, dec) x6 (30)
- (3 sc, dec) x6 (24)
- (2 sc, dec) x6 (18)
- dec x9 (9)
FO, stuff firmly, sew to top of body.
👀 Eyes (Make 2)
Outer Eye (Color B):
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- inc x6 (12)
- (1 sc, inc) x6 (18)
FO.
Pupil (Color C):
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- inc x6 (12)
FO, sew to center of white circle.
Attach eyes to head, spaced evenly.
🐽 Muzzle
With Color B:
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- inc x6 (12)
- (1 sc, inc) x6 (18)
- sc around (18)
FO, stuff lightly, sew centered below eyes.
Embroider nose with Color D, mouth with Color C.
🐰 Ears (Make 2)
Outer Ear (Color A):
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- (1 sc, inc) x3 (9)
- (2 sc, inc) x3 (12)
- (3 sc, inc) x3 (15)
- (4 sc, inc) x3 (18)
- (5 sc, inc) x3 (21)
FO, flatten.
Inner Ear (Color D – pink):
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- (1 sc, inc) x3 (9)
- (2 sc, inc) x3 (12)
- (3 sc, inc) x3 (15)
- (4 sc, inc) x3 (18)
FO, sew inside outer ear.
Attach ears to head symmetrically.
🐈 Whiskers
Cut 6 strands of black yarn. Insert 3 on each side of the muzzle, secure with knots inside.
🐾 Tail
With Color A:
- MR, 6 sc (6)
- inc x6 (12)
3–35. sc around (12) – adjust for length.
FO, stuff lightly, sew to back of base.
✂️ Assembly & Finishing
- Sew base to bottom of body.
- Attach pockets around body evenly.
- Attach head securely.
- Sew ears, muzzle, and eyes in place.
- Add whiskers.
- Position tail on back.
